If create a loop device with a backing NVMe SSD, current loop device driver doesn't correctly set its queue's limits.discard_granularity and leaves it as 0. If a discard request at LBA 0 on this loop device, in __blkdev_issue_discard() the calculated req_sects will be 0, and a zero length discard request will trigger a BUG() panic in generic block layer code at block/blk-mq.c:563. # losetup -f /dev/nvme0n1 --direct-io=on # blkdiscard /dev/loop0 -o 0 -l 0x200 This patch fixes the issue by checking q->limits.discard_granularity in __blkdev_issue_discard() before composing the discard bio. If the value is 0, then prints a warning oops information and returns -EOPNOTSUPP to the caller to indicate that this buggy device driver doesn't support discard request.The patch itself looks correct to me.quoted
